This is the sixth year that the Junior Writers Programme has been held. All 20 writers worked hard to whip up a story, with some having to amend their tales along the way. Through the seven months, they learned how to develop a story and explore all angles while collaborating with an editor.
As with previous years, the royalties from the sale of this book go to charity. This year’s recipient is Yayasan Chow Kit, a non-profit organisation serving the needs of children and teens in the Chow Kit area of Kuala Lumpur.
